The short version

Nacogdoches has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$28,301. Population has held roughly steady since 1990. Median home value is $65,500. At a median age of 29.7, residents skew younger than the country as a whole. The poverty rate of 23.3% is well above the national figure.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Nacogdoches, TX?

Nacogdoches, TX has about 59,203 residents according to the 2000 Census.

What is the median household income in Nacogdoches, TX?

The typical household in Nacogdoches, TX earns about $28,301 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Nacogdoches, TX expensive?

In Nacogdoches, TX, the median home is worth about $65,500, and the typical rent is about $465 a month.

How educated are people in Nacogdoches, TX?

About 22.8% of adults age 25 and over in Nacogdoches, TX h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Nacogdoches, TX?

About 23.3% of people in Nacogdoches, TX live below the federal poverty line.

Has Nacogdoches, TX grown since 1990?

Yes, Nacogdoches, TX has grown since 1990. The population has added about 4,450 residents, a change of about 8 percent over that period.
